So far so good. It's a very straight to the point app. When you click on it, it automatically turns the flashlight on without needing to press another "on" button to turn it on once you're in the app like other flashlight apps. No ads, no weird unecessary features. There is an option for adjustible strobe lighting that you can turn on, but unless you turn it on, it stays off. The overall simplicity of this with no ad bombardments is what makes this superior to other flashlight apps imo.

This was very annoying to use. I downloaded it when I needed to see in my dark basement to fix something and was already impatient. My advice to the developers would be to not rethink the wheel. The design is cool, that is enough. It was very difficult finding the on/off button, when most flashlights it is already established to turn it on and off by tapping the flashlight icon. Everytime I pushed a button to figure out how it worked another ad would come on.

I use this for a magic trick, its a d'lite for my clients. But the ads of other 🔦 ruin the effect. This one is the best by just a hair! 1. Love that the light turns on upon opening the app. 2. Hate the ads popping up after 2nd click. I need 4 clicks before ad pops up Or Option to watch a LONG ad for no ads all day. 3. Need to increase the size of the button, make button movable to anywhere on screen or make it where tapping anywhere on the screen will turn light on and off.
